Cartoon: How does managed IT services work for construction businesses?

Managed IT services for construction businesses provide ongoing technology support through a dedicated help desk, proactive network monitoring, data backup, and security solutions. Construction companies typically pay $150–$225 per user per month for comprehensive managed services that include remote support, on-site technician dispatch, and coordination across multiple job sites—eliminating the need for internal IT staff while ensuring estimating software, project management tools, and field connectivity remain operational during critical bid deadlines.

What technology challenges do construction companies face on Vancouver Island?

Construction firms operating across Victoria, Nanaimo, Duncan, and rural Vancouver Island job sites struggle with coordinating technology between site offices and headquarters. Field staff need access to project plans, RFIs, and daily reports from locations with unreliable cellular connectivity. When estimating software crashes hours before a tender deadline, there’s no time to wait for a callback.

Heritage building renovations and seismic upgrade projects in Victoria require extensive digital documentation to meet BC Building Code requirements. WorkSafeBC mandates digital incident reporting with strict timelines. The Builders Lien Act demands meticulous record-keeping with specific deadlines—a single data loss event can jeopardize lien rights worth hundreds of thousands of dollars.

Public sector construction projects involving universities, hospitals, and government buildings must comply with FIPPA (Freedom of Information and Protection of Privacy Act). This adds layers of security and privacy requirements that most small to mid-sized contractors aren’t equipped to handle without dedicated IT expertise.

What does proactive monitoring prevent in construction operations?

Managed IT providers monitor your network, servers, and workstations 24/7, identifying problems before they disrupt operations. Disk space monitoring prevents estimating databases from failing mid-calculation because storage filled up overnight. Memory alerts catch issues before accounting software crashes during month-end billing.

Security monitoring detects ransomware attempts targeting construction companies—a growing threat as cybercriminals recognize that contractors will pay quickly to meet project deadlines. Automated patch management keeps systems current with security updates without requiring your office manager to remember monthly maintenance.

Backup verification ensures your daily backups actually work. Many construction companies discover backup failures only when trying to recover lost data. Proactive monitoring tests backup integrity regularly, confirming that shop drawings, as-builts, and financial records are recoverable.

Network performance monitoring identifies bandwidth bottlenecks before they prevent field staff from uploading daily reports or downloading updated plans. When multiple users access large BIM files simultaneously, monitoring helps optimize network configuration for construction-specific workflows.

Proactive monitoring typically reduces emergency support calls by 60-70% by catching issues during maintenance windows rather than during critical work periods.

This approach shifts IT from reactive firefighting to planned maintenance that aligns with construction schedules.

How does data backup work for construction documentation requirements?

Construction companies generate massive amounts of critical data: contracts, change orders, progress photos, as-builts, warranties, and correspondence. The Builders Lien Act requires specific documentation within tight timelines—missing a deadline can forfeit lien rights on a project worth hundreds of thousands of dollars.

Managed IT services implement automated daily backups that capture all business data without requiring staff intervention. Backups run overnight when systems aren’t busy with estimating or project coordination. Multiple backup copies exist: one on-site for quick recovery and one off-site (typically cloud-based) for disaster protection.

Heritage renovation projects in Victoria often span years and require maintaining complete documentation throughout. Backup retention policies keep historical project data accessible for warranty work, deficiency resolution, or legal disputes that emerge long after substantial completion.

FIPPA compliance for public sector projects requires specific data handling and retention practices. Data backup and recovery systems designed for construction businesses incorporate these requirements, ensuring that government project documentation meets provincial privacy standards.

Recovery testing verifies that backed-up data actually restores correctly. A backup system that fails during recovery is worthless. Regular testing confirms that if your estimating workstation fails the morning of a bid deadline, all takeoff data can be restored to a replacement computer within an hour.

Automated backup eliminates the risk of human error—no one forgets to back up before leaving the site office on Friday.

What security measures protect construction companies from cyber threats?

Construction firms increasingly face targeted cyberattacks. Criminals know contractors work on tight deadlines and will pay ransoms to avoid project delays. Email phishing attacks impersonate suppliers requesting payment to fraudulent accounts. Subcontractors with weak security become entry points to your network.

Managed security solutions start with network firewalls that block malicious traffic before it reaches your systems. Email filtering catches phishing attempts and malware attachments before they reach your project managers’ inboxes. Spam protection costs $5–$15 per user per month and prevents the majority of email-based threats.

Comprehensive cybersecurity suites ($25–$50 per device per month) include endpoint protection for laptops and workstations, monitoring for suspicious activity, and automated threat response. When a field laptop connects to an unsecured job site network, security software prevents malware from spreading to your main office systems.

Password management enforces strong, unique passwords across all systems and applications. Construction companies often share passwords among project teams, creating security vulnerabilities. Managed IT providers implement password controls that balance security with the collaborative nature of construction work.

Cyber awareness training ($5–$15 per user per month) teaches staff to recognize phishing emails, suspicious links, and social engineering attempts. How does multi-site support work across Vancouver Island job sites?

Construction companies operate across dispersed locations: head office in Victoria, active job sites in Nanaimo and Duncan, and field staff working from home or temporary site offices. Managed IT services coordinate technology across all these locations through centralized management and local technician availability.

Remote support handles most issues regardless of location. A superintendent in a Cobble Hill site office receives the same immediate help desk response as someone at headquarters. VPN connections allow secure access to project files, estimating software, and accounting systems from any location with internet connectivity.

When job sites have limited or unreliable internet, IT providers configure offline capabilities for critical applications. Field staff can complete daily reports, time tracking, and safety documentation without connectivity, with automatic synchronization when they return to connected locations.

Local technicians stationed across Vancouver Island provide on-site support when remote resolution isn’t possible. If a site office experiences network equipment failure during a critical inspection, a technician from the nearest location responds quickly. This local presence matters during bid preparation when every hour counts.

Cloud-based project management and collaboration tools enable real-time coordination between office staff and field teams. Document management systems ensure everyone works from current plans and specifications, reducing costly errors from outdated information.

Mobile device management secures and supports smartphones and tablets used by field staff for photos, inspections, and communication. When devices are lost or stolen from job sites, remote wipe capabilities protect sensitive project data.

Multi-site support eliminates the technology barriers that prevent efficient coordination across dispersed construction operations.

What does the transition process look like when starting managed IT services?

Switching to managed IT services begins with a comprehensive network assessment. IT providers evaluate your current systems, identify security vulnerabilities, document software licenses, and review backup procedures. This assessment reveals issues you may not know exist—outdated servers, failing hard drives, or security gaps.

The assessment produces a prioritized roadmap addressing critical issues first, then implementing improvements as budget allows. Construction companies often can’t afford to replace everything simultaneously. A phased approach tackles the most urgent problems (like inadequate backups or security vulnerabilities) before addressing performance improvements or system upgrades.

During transition, managed IT providers document your systems, create network diagrams, inventory hardware and software, and establish baseline performance metrics. This documentation proves invaluable during warranty claims, insurance reviews, or when planning future technology investments.

  • Initial network assessment and vulnerability scan (typically 1-2 weeks)
  • Priority issue remediation and security hardening (2-4 weeks)
  • System documentation and baseline establishment (1-2 weeks)
  • User training on help desk access and security protocols (ongoing)
  • Phased implementation of monitoring, backup, and management tools (2-4 weeks)

User training ensures your team knows how to access help desk support, use new security tools, and follow backup procedures. Construction staff need simple, clear instructions that don’t require technical expertise.

The transition typically takes 30-90 days depending on the complexity of existing systems and the extent of repairs needed. Throughout this period, you maintain operations while improvements happen in the background.

Once fully transitioned, you have predictable monthly IT costs, immediate access to support, and confidence that technology won’t derail project deadlines.
